What types of physical activity do you enjoy? My main true love is HEAVY, low rep weight lifting, but I also love long walks on the beach, swimming, and biking. I’ve recently fallen in love with hiking/mountain climbing as well after climbing the Half Dome in Yosemite over the summer! BEST HIKE EVER!!!

How did you get started in weight lifting? It’s actually a pretty crazy story. Back in 2009, I was going through my senior year of high school. Everything was great until I lost my best friend to a life of partying, sex, and drugs. I was already stressed out about graduation, college applications, and the future, so losing my closest friend was hard. Stress made me develop an eating disorder and I got down to a REALLY unhealthy weight.
I realized what harm I was doing to my body when my family and I went to one of those anatomy “Body World” exhibits in February 2010. Passing by a mirror, I saw what I had become–I resembled the preserved people in the exhibit! Mortified, I started doing research on healthy ways to gain weight because I was sick of “punishing” myself with restriction of food. I discovered bodybuilding.com and was immediately inspired by athletes like Erin Stern and Dana Linn Bailey. They were STRONG, healthy and badass chicks, not frail, depressed girls. My new goal was to gain muscle and fuel my body in a way that would get me results. So, I buried myself in nutrition and weight training books, bought a tub of whey protein, and started out with a simple full body 3-day split. I’ve been loving it ever since! Now I work with a bodybuilding coach that’s fine tuning everything to help me reach my ultimate goal: gain enough mass to compete in a figure show!

Favorite workout or lift? I really love chin ups, upright rows, and pendlay rows. But I think my all time fave has to be SQUATS of all types!! 😀 You just feel so powerful when you bust out that last rep!

Piece of advice for new lifters or those reluctant to try:
#1 Don’t be afraid!! You won’t get bulky, you won’t look manly, you’ll feel AWESOME
#2 Everyone’s gotta start somewhere.
#3 You don’t need a full gym membership to get results—I workout at home with a barbell, plates, pullup bar, bench, and a homemade squat rack!
#4 Goals ARE achievable!!!
